usb cdc, compiled and enumerated, but don't know how to use

Question asked by zhao.frank on Nov 7, 2011
Latest reply on Nov 10, 2011 by Domen Puncer
I've compiled the USB CDC code from the STM32F4Discovery example code using YAGARTO. It enumerates, the .inf driver is working, I can open the COM port using Realterm.

I have programmed the DataRx and DataTx callbacks in cdc_core_if.c to toggle a LED specific to which one was invoked

I can open up the terminal, type a character into it, and that LED will turn on

But my problem is that I can't get the LED to turn off, but my code is supposed to toggle this LED on every callback

The TX indicator inside Realterm will blink on the first keystroke, but on the second keystroke, the indicator will light up and stay lit

How am I supposed to properly implement a virtual serial port using USB CDC?